On your doorstep

Make the most of the nature on your doorstep, with woodland walks along the river accessible two-minutes away.

Also walkable from the door is Bromley Cross, with its array of shops including a Sainsbury’s Local, Co-op, mini market, boutique clothes shop and railway station. Astley Bridge also offers a range of local shops and supermarkets within walking distance.

For trips out with the children, head to the Vue Cinema and Nuffield Gym in The Valley.

Families are perfectly placed for a number of local schools, including The Oaks and Sharples Primary schools along with Sharples High School, Canon Slade, and Thornleigh Salesian College.

Professionals can commute with ease, within 15-20 minutes’ drive of the M60/M65 motorway network. For rail travel, catch a train from Bromley Cross or Hall i'th’ Wood stations (15 minutes' walk or a five-minute drive) where direct trains connect you with Manchester city centre. Frequent bus services run on the hour to Bolton town from down Ashworth Lane.
